Healthy Egg Bacon Mushroom and Cheddar Muffins Recipe for Breakfast or Snacks

Ingredients


To create a batch of these delectable muffins, you'll need:


  • 5 eggs

  • 2 tablespoons semi-skimmed milk

  • 4 tablespoons melted butter plus a little for greasing the muffin tin

  • 1 cup grated cheddar cheese

  • A sprinkle of salt and pepper to taste

  • 3 slices streaky bacon

  • 1 cup finely chopped mushrooms

  • 1 cup plain flour

  • Heaped tablespoon baking powder

  • Half an onion


Don't forget to prepare a 12-hole muffin tin, greaseproof baking parchment paper, and an ice cream scoop for this recipe!


Preparation Steps To Make The Healthy Egg Muffins


Preheat the Oven


First, preheat your oven to 200°C (about 400°F). This step is crucial for even baking, ensuring your muffins turn out light and fluffy.


Grease the Muffin Tin


While the oven heats, grease the muffin tin holes with butter or cooking spray. This prevents sticking and makes for an easier clean-up.


Cook the Bacon


In a medium pan, cook the streaky bacon over medium heat until crispy. This usually takes about 5-7 minutes. Once ready, remove it, let it cool, and chop it into small pieces.


Close-up view of crispy bacon pieces on a cutting board
Crispy bacon pieces ready for muffin mixture

Sauté the Vegetables


Use the same pan and add 2 tablespoons of melted butter. Toss in the finely chopped mushrooms and half an onion. Sauté until the mushrooms are soft and the onion is clear, about 4-5 minutes. Once cooked, let the mixture cool down alongside the bacon.


Mix the Dry Ingredients


In a large mixing bowl, combine the plain flour, baking powder, salt, and pepper. Stir in the grated cheddar cheese, which gives the muffins a cheesy goodness in every bite!


Whisk the Wet Ingredients


In another bowl, whisk together the eggs, semi-skimmed milk, and the remaining 2 tablespoons of melted butter. This mixture will bind all the elements together and add moisture.


Combine Wet and Dry Ingredients


Now, pour the wet ingredients into the dry mixture and gently fold them together. Avoid overmixing; a few lumps will help keep the muffins fluffy.


Eye-level view of eggs and whisk ready to make egg muffin mixture
Eggs and whisk are prepared on a marble countertop, ready to create a delicious egg muffin mixture.

Fold in the Bacon and Vegetables


Gently fold in the bacon, sautéed mushrooms, and onion. This is where the flavours really start to come alive.


Scoop into Muffin Tin


Using an ice cream scoop, fill each muffin hole about three-quarters full to allow room for them to rise.



Bake the Muffins


Place the muffin tin in the preheated oven and bake for about 15 minutes. Check for doneness by inserting a skewer into the centre; it should come out clean. The tops should be golden brown and puffed.


Cool and Store


Let the muffins cool in the tin for a few minutes before moving them to a wire rack. Wrap each muffin in baking parchment to store in the fridge, or freeze them for up to three months—great for future snacking!


Tips for Customisation


Make it Vegetarian


Switch out the bacon for fresh spinach or your favourite veggies. This swap still results in a delicious, nutritious muffin that anyone can enjoy.


Add More Flavour


Experiment with herbs and spices to kick things up a notch. A sprinkle of paprika or a dash of garlic powder can add an exciting twist.


Cheese Variations


While cheddar is a classic, try using feta, mozzarella, cottage cheese or a spicy pepper jack cheese for a fun variation.


Serving Suggestions


These versatile muffins can be enjoyed in many ways. Consider serving them warm with a dollop of Greek yogurt or alongside fresh fruit for a healthy breakfast option. They also stand out as a quick snack or paired with a light salad for lunch.
